Top tips for flying out of Chicago Rockford International Airport (RFD) on Alaska Airlines to Bellingham (BLI)
- Utilize off-peak flying hours for your journey. Analyses indicate that midweek, especially Wednesday, seems to be the least crowded at Chicago Rockford International Airport and thus may expedite your check-in and security screening process.
- The airline Alaska, servicing the Rockford-Bellingham route, stipulates a specific carry-on bag size. Ensure that your carry-on luggage fits comfortably in the overhead bin by sticking strictly to the specified dimensions of 22 x 14 x 9 inches.
- Bellingham International Airport boasts unique local restaurants. Leave room in your itinerary to indulge in flavors unique to the Pacific Northwest like Wild Buffalos in the main terminal. This culinary experience could be a fine and gratifying capstone to your journey.
- Parking at Chicago Rockford International Airport can be quite challenging during peak travel times. Utilize pre-booking options via the airport's official website to mitigate this hurdle. Not only does this guarantee a space for your vehicle but may also bring cost-saving benefits.
- Ensure that your carry-on bag contains essential items for acclimatization to Bellingham's rainy weather. Important could be a lightweight rain jacket or umbrella. Being prepared facilitates a more comfortable transition upon landing.
- Paying attention to Alaska's specific baggage allowance rules are paramount. The Airline allows one personal item and one carry-on free, however, checked bags will incur additional costs. Keeping your packing efficient could lay the groundwork for a smoother journey.
- Bellingham International Airport is smaller in size compared to other major airports. Leverage this by padding less time into your arrival plans at the destination end. Being aware of this enables you to plan judiciously when scheduling any post-flight activities.

Now, speaking of considerations for the truly airline-savvy traveler, let's talk about flight cancellation policies. Unforeseen circumstances, we know, can sometimes put a damper on travel plans. That’s why it's critical to understand the fine print when booking. A fully refundable ticket can be costly but provides the highest level of flexibility. Non-refundable tickets, while lighter on the pocket, can turn pricey if you need to reschedule. It's all about balancing those risks with the potential benefits.
